A new boules court has been opened at Scoil Mhuire, Strokestown.

A new boules court has been opened at a County Roscommon school.

There was great excitement on  International Day of the Francophonie (French-speaking world) with the opening of a boules court at Scoil Mhuire, Strokestown. 

The guest of honour, suitably attired, was the chief architect of this boules court, Monsieur Compton. 

All First Year students took part in a league to mark the opening. 

The school also thanks also to Mr Keighran, David Brudell and Mr Horan for their work in getting this court up and running.
